Hi Rhialdor, allow me to give you some feedback on your application as you request.

There's an old quote that goes "You only get one chance to make a good first impression", and I'm sorry to say that your application in the first instance didn't really give us a good first impression. There wasn't the sort of information in it that we would like to see, that informs us about you personally, and also your class knowledge.

As we are currently looking for a serious hunter to round out our team for Ulduar, we gave you a second chance to impress us by asking some further questions. Unfortunately you didn't grasp this chance as we would have hoped, and therefore we had to decline your application to trial.

As a minimum we would expect potential applicants to have had a good look at our recruitment forums, and see which applications obviously impressed us, leading to trial, and which applications were too poor for us to consider, leading to a decline, and write an application of a similar quality to those successful ones. It's what I would do if I was writing an application to any guild.
